Major Responsibilities:
- Oversee the implementation at school level and work closely with Education Field Coordinator
- Conducting daily follow up on the implementation of the programme’s activities in the schools, including monitoring students’ attendance and absenteeism, awareness raising, parents’ meetings, follow up with the counselors and teachers, supporting extracurricular clubs, forming PTA etc.
- Conduct community engagement sessions (when needed) in support to outreach volunteers.
- Support the school staff in collecting all the needed data related to students and their performance: child registration, family assessment form and Pre/post tests and other information related to the project activities
- Follow up on children attendance at school level and ensure retention of children
- Follow up on establishment of school clubs and support school directors in implementing the different components of the programme.
- Monitor teacher qualifications and ensure that the staff hired meets the criteria developed and endorsed by MEHE
- Support the data entry volunteer/IM focal point per school in updating the database system and CLM with data and attendance.
- Support the school staff in the planning and the implementation of regular extracurricular activities
- Support the school staff in identifying caregivers to be engaged in the awareness program for parents and in organizing the sessions (orientation sessions at the beginning of the program and portfolio day at the end).
- Provide continuous communication and feedbacks to caregivers. In addition, when needed, organize ad-hoc sessions with caregivers as per the emergent needs of children aiming to respond to alarming behaviors.
- Ensure quality material is available for the programme, RMF and donor’s visibility.

Job Requirements:
- Bachelor’s degree in Education or any related field
- Relevant experience in education.
- Strong knowledge of inclusive practices and relevant legal frameworks.
- Experience in conducting training, workshops, or community engagement activities.
- Demonstrated ability to work with diverse groups and promote inclusive values.
- Excellent communication, facilitation, and interpersonal skills.
- Experience working in humanitarian sector is desirable.
- Excellent knowledge of formal and non-formal education programs in Lebanon.
- Proficiency in spoken and written Arabic and English.
- Strong interpersonal, communication, coordination, and presentation skills.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, PPT, Excel). Good knowledge of Kobo and Washington Group Survey is an asset.
- Skilled in report writing.
- Trustworthy and good listener.
- High sense of discretion in always dealing with confidential matters.
- High integrity and honesty; ability to deal tactfully and discreetly with people, situations, and information.
- Acceptance of diversity and inclusion as core values.
